Output 3b11b689e61d931e4af568ba5fd713c3019f3157899a2de073fcd88f77bbe06d:23

value
1030000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67c535d961cfa47c27a3fac6bb16d0ab2a20b9c6 OP_EQUAL
address
3B9hmiZvuwNaQE9iEHNwg4uv9TjKhWjUQi
transaction
3b11b689e61d931e4af568ba5fd713c3019f3157899a2de073fcd88f77bbe06d
spent
true